From f80ef6a32b28f54415f79513537f6c9fcd58a244 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: "Eric Wong (Contractor, The Linux Foundation)" Date: Fri, 2 Mar 2018 19:32:19 +0000 Subject: v2writable: inject new Message-IDs on true duplicates Since we'll need to support multiple Message-IDs anyways, inject a new one if we hit a duplicate (or don't get one at all).
